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Cheam to Netherfield start from as little as £17.90

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Cheam to Netherfield start from £86.20 one way, or £90.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Cheam to Netherfield are available for £118.50 one way, or £232.20 return

Station Facilities

Cheam Station features a ticket office with extensive opening hours from Monday through Sunday, complemented by ticket machines for a hassle-free buying and collection process. Conveniently, these machines support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, offering accessibility for varied needs. The station ensures enhanced commuter experience with available refreshment facilities - though it lacks an ATM or shops.

Customer support is a priority at Cheam, with helpful staff available from early morning until after midnight on all days. For travelers needing assistance, customer help points are strategically situated on platforms, ensuring service accessibility any time of the day. Unfortunately, the station lacks luggage storage services and has no waiting rooms, but there are seating areas on the platform for passengers to use while waiting for their trains.

Accessibility and Support

The inclusive ethos extends to accessibility, with step-free access to both platforms, although transferring between platforms without steps isn't available. An assistance meeting point on Platform 2 and the availability of a ramp for train access further enhance the station's accessibility. However, do note that there are no accessible toilets on site.

Parking your vehicle is straightforward with 119 spaces available, including 3 accessible spaces. The station also offers bicycle storage facilities, though they aren't sheltered, and no bicycle hire facilities are currently available on-site. For those who drive, there's the convenience of free parking operated by APCOA Parking UK, ensuring that your journey begins seamlessly.

Facilities and Amenities

Though the station might not boast extensive facilities, it does cater to essential needs. There’s no ticket office, but 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ting your tickets. While smartcards aren’t issued here, they can be validated, and there’s an induction loop available for those with hearing impairments.

If you require assistance, there’s a help point at the station. However, it's worth noting that the station lacks step-free access, which is something to keep in mind if mobility is an issue—contact the helpline to arrange passenger assistance in advance. While CCTV is operational for added security, facilities such as toilets, waiting rooms, seating, and refreshments are not available on-site.
